Subaverage Intellectual Functioning

A term denoting lower than average intellectual capabilities, which can impact learning and adaptive abilities.

Profound Intellectual Disability

A level of intellectual disability characterized by significant limitations in both cognitive functioning and adaptive behavior, manifesting before 18 years of age.

Sensory Impairments

Involves the loss or diminished function of one or more of the senses, including hearing, vision, taste, smell, and touch.

Autism Spectrum Disorder

A range of neurodevelopmental disorders characterized by challenges with social skills, repetitive behaviors, speech, and nonverbal communication.
